Anyone Watching Alone on History Channel?

Have not looked it up, and hope its all it seems to be.

Basic premise is 10 people (outdoor survival experts) sent with no crew to various individual locations on Pacific coast of Canada.  Basic supplies (Knife, tarp, fire steel, bag and bottle), no crew, motion detection cameras and a handheld.
Whoever last's the longest wins 500k.  Environment is full of Bears, Cougars and Wolves yearly rainfall is measured in feet, it is basically an unforgiving place.  The bravado of the participants lasts about half a day.  The psychological unravelling of the participants is fascinating - solitude does very strange things to people.

If it turns out to be staged I will be upset, as its brilliant so far.
Highly recommended - is available on catch up.
